Let’s throw it back to (I think) 1986, when the NFL did a nice feature on the officials. In this feature was referee Gene Barth, and his entire crew. On the crew that year were umpire Ed Fiffick, head linesman Frank Glover, line judge Ray Dodez, back judge Paul Baetz, side judge (and future referee) Gerald Austin, and field judge Ed Merrifield. The back judge and field judge names were swapped in the late 1990s.

The feature shows how the crew prepares for a game each week, and each crew member goes over their position and duties.

This footage is courtesy of the Ray Dodez family.
